                          | Ancient Malwa - post-Mauryan copper punch-marked coin, (c.250-200 BC), copying symbols from silver Karshapana coinage, unpublished in PAIC, 1.64g. Obv: Five symbols - 1. Sun, 2. Six-armed symbol, 3. Tree-in-railing, 4. Three-arched hill with crescent, 5. Bull facing right. Rev: the same configuration as obverse but struck in a different order. | Estimate Rs. 4,000-5,000
